A stunning new story from the bestselling, prize-winning David Almond, unfolding the magic of the everyday. Mina, from the unforgettable Skellig and My Name is Mina, journeys to Japan and discovers the wonders of the world around her.Kyoto, Japan. Mina is on a bus. Everything is strange and beautiful.Mina watches as a woman folds a piece of paper into an origami boat, then floats it over to her.As Mina discovers the magic of origami, her eyes are opened to the wonders of the real city around her.Unfold the magic of the everyday, on a journey with one of the world's best-loved authors - with stunning illustrations from Kirsti Beautyman in black and orange throughout.
